Bangkok: Man Karin and his volunteer team went to Sanam Luang to distribute royal food, expressing their gratitude for His Majesty’s grace. They aimed to support those who came to pay their respects to the royal urn of Her Majesty Queen Sirikit the Queen Mother at Dusit Maha Prasat Throne Hall in the Grand Palace.
According to Thai News Agency, Man Karin and Ajarn Be Ommatra organized a group of volunteers, including prominent figures such as Jui Jorsaphan Sawatdiwat Na Ayutthaya, Noodee Rassarin (Mrs. Globe Thailand 2025), and Beauty Napapat Luanchawee. The team distributed royal food and snacks provided by Dr. Songwit Jirasopin and Kae Sopin Rongrat to the public gathered at the event. The offerings included 400 sets of sticky rice with pork and fried chicken, 120 sets of bread, and 200 sets of snacks, all intended to boost the morale of those paying their respects.
The event took place at Sanam Luang, opposite Thammasat University, drawing a significant number of attendees who appreciated the support and generosity shown by the volunteer team.
